I actually kind of see his point. His target average did go down quite a bit over the last several weeks last season. There are even a few games in there with only 2-3 targets like he said. Last game of the year in Denver he had 3 targets and 1 catch for 2 yds. Bizarre. I didn’t remember that.

But the bottom line is that he still finished the year near the top of the league in targets. And with the most targets he’s had in a Chiefs uniform (by a lot). I think it was a Chiefs record. While sharing the field with one of the greatest TEs ever. Just laughably narcissistic. I assume he’s smart enough to understand that with the amount of attention that he draws from defenses, there will be times that they have to go elsewhere. And the offense was at its best down the stretch, so he can’t pretend that it was detrimental to the team.

It’s funny that he claims to have no ill will toward anybody, including Veach, yet he’s chomping at the bit to play KC and make a statement.

At some point it was rumored that the Chiefs camp felt like he was stunting Mahomes’ growth as a QB and also that he wasn’t the world’s greatest teammate behind closed doors. I have to think there’s truth to that. Otherwise, I doubt they let him go over a few million per. If he were a less selfish player, I’m betting he’d still be in KC.
